How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sherman Avenue?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Sherman Avenue Studio Apartments | $919 | $655 | $1,118 |
Sherman Avenue 1 Bedroom Apartments | $929 | $660 | $1,385 |
Sherman Avenue 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,064 | $680 | $1,750 |
Sherman Avenue 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,435 | $550 | $2,097 |
Sherman Avenue 4 Bedroom Apartments | $997 | $599 | $2,700 |

Quick Rent Budget Calculator
How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
